Instructions For Scrumptious The Finest Teriyaki Chicken Skewers You’ll Ever Make

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

First Step: Marinate the Chicken

Begin by cutting your boneless, skinless chicken breasts into bite-sized cubes. In a mixing bowl, combine soy sauce, brown sugar, honey, minced garlic, grated ginger, and rice vinegar. Whisk until well combined. Add chicken cubes to the marinade and let them soak for at least 30 minutes in the refrigerator. This ensures maximum flavor infusion.

Second Step: Prepare Your Skewers

While your chicken marinates, soak wooden skewers in water for about 15 minutes. This prevents them from burning on the grill. If using metal skewers, simply skip this step.

Third Step: Preheat Your Grill

Heat your grill to medium-high heat (about 400°F or 200°C). If using an oven or broiler, preheat it now as well.

Fourth Step: Assemble Skewers

Remove chicken from marinade and thread onto skewers evenly spaced apart. Remember not to overcrowd them; proper airflow will help cook them evenly.

Fifth Step: Grill or Bake

Place skewers on preheated grill or baking sheet if using an oven. Grill each side for about 5-7 minutes or until fully cooked through and slightly charred. Baste with remaining marinade during grilling for added flavor.

Transfer to plates and drizzle with extra teriyaki sauce for the perfect finishing touch.

Expert Tips

Here are some helpful tips to ensure the best results for your dish:

  • Use Fresh Ingredients: Always opt for fresh garlic and ginger; they significantly enhance flavor compared to their powdered counterparts.

  • Don’t Skip Marinading Time: Allowing chicken to marinate longer than recommended can intensify its flavor; overnight is ideal if time permits.

  • Alternate Vegetables on Skewers: Feel free to add bell peppers, onions, or zucchini between pieces of chicken for added color and nutrients.

Cooking Tips for Teriyaki Chicken Skewers

To achieve Scrumptious The Finest Teriyaki Chicken Skewers You’ll Ever Make, follow these essential cooking tips. Start with high-quality chicken breast or thighs for the best flavor and tenderness. Marinate your chicken for at least 30 minutes, but ideally up to 2 hours, to enhance the taste. When skewering, ensure the pieces are evenly cut so they cook uniformly. Preheat your grill or pan to medium-high heat before adding the skewers. This step helps achieve that perfect char and caramelization on the outside while keeping the inside juicy.

Storage Instructions

To maintain their delicious flavor, store any leftover Scrumptious The Finest Teriyaki Chicken Skewers You’ll Ever Make in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They can last up to three days. If you want to keep them longer, consider freezing them. Place them in a freezer-safe bag, removing excess air to prevent freezer burn. Thaw overnight in the refrigerator before reheating.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 34 breasts)
  • 3 cloves fresh garlic, minced
  • 1 tbsp fresh ginger, grated
  • ½ cup low-sodium soy sauce
  • ¼ cup brown sugar
  • 2 tbsp honey
  • 2 tbsp rice vinegar
  • Wooden skewers (soaked in water)

Instructions

  1. Cut chicken breasts into bite-sized cubes. In a bowl, whisk together soy sauce, brown sugar, honey, minced garlic, grated ginger, and rice vinegar. Add chicken cubes to the marinade and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.
  2. While chicken marinates, soak wooden skewers in water for about 15 minutes.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at (about 400°F).
  3. Remove chicken from marinade and thread onto skewers evenly spaced apart.
  4. Grill skewers for about 5-7 minutes on each side until fully cooked and slightly charred. Baste with remaining marinade while grilling.
  5. Serve hot with extra teriyaki sauce drizzled on top.
